What type of ship is this?

SATURN (IMO 8890138) is a Dry bulk/Mini bulkers 1 ship built in 1995 and is sailing under the flag of Mongolia. She has an overall length (LOA) of 59 meters and a width (beam) of 9 meters. Her summer deadweight capacity is 292 tonnes.
